Blood vessel - normal tissue. Aorta: there is strong cytoplasmic immunolabeling of endothelial cells of the aorta for platelet-derived growth factor alpha (antibody diluted at 1:25, tissue fixed in IHC Zinc fixative, heat-mediated antigen retrieval in citrate buffer at pH=6.0). There is also mild multifocal staining of the connective tissue in the wall of the aorta. This pattern of immunolabeling was consistently detected with this antibody but it may represent an artifact. |
